BAD SODEN, Germany - Bicycles and e-bikes have become the mode of transport of the hour, defying the corona crisis, the German bicycle association, Zweirad-Industrie-Verband (ZIV) says. Figures they released today show a 15.8% increase in e-bike sales in Germany in the first half of 2020 and the association is optimistic about reaching 2019 sales levels by year end.

NEW YORK, US - Bolt Bikes, the Australian mobility startup, has completed a Series A capital raise of US$11 million (€9.3 million) to invest in expanding its operations in the United States. Along with the capital raise, the e-bike sharing subscription service has announced that is rebranding with a new name, Zoomo.
DIEREN, the Netherlands - Gazelle is to build a new experience centre right next to its factory in Dieren, the Netherlands. A unique feature is that visitors can also follow the entire production process of the bicycles via a footbridge suspended in the factory hall.
